Carmen Santiago Obituary
Carmen Santiago of Brooklyn, NY passed away on Thursday, February 24, 2022 in Brooklyn Hospital, Brooklyn, NY. The daughter of Felix and Mercedes Gonzalez Santiago, she was born on April 28, 1937 in Arroyo, Puerto Rico. She was 84 years old. She was an employee of Sweet & Low, Brooklyn.
Carmen is survived by her daughter Neida Baron-Cadiz (Kelli Baron-Cadiz) of Maybrook; grandchildren, Andrew and Brandon. Other members of her family are her sons, grandchildren, great grandchildren, nieces and nephews, and her pet dog, Chita.
A visitation will be held on Sunday, February 27th from 2-4 PM at the Gridley-Horan Funeral Home, 39 Orchard St., Walden, NY. Funeral services will be held at 4 PM at the funeral home following the visitation. Cremation will be in the Cedar Hill Crematory, Newburgh. Memorial contributions may be made to the Walden Humane Society, 2489 Albany Post Road, Walden, NY 12586.
